Job Overview
We seek a highly skilled Lead Mechanical Engineer to drive the design and development of complex commercial HVAC systems in Los Angeles, CA. This role focuses on large-scale commercial, healthcare, and industrial projects and requires deep expertise in chillers, boilers, hydronic piping, ductwork, and building automation systems. The ideal candidate will have advanced proficiency in Revit, AutoCAD, and Navisworks, ensuring high-quality, efficient, and code-compliant designs.

Key Responsibilities
  • Lead the mechanical design for commercial HVAC projects, including chilled water, hot water, VRF, and air distribution systems.
  • Develop and review detailed engineering drawings using AutoCAD, Revit, and Navisworks, ensuring compliance with ASHRAE standards, Title 24, and California Mechanical Code.
  • Conduct load calculations, energy modeling, and system performance analysis to enhance efficiency and sustainability.
  • Collaborate closely with project managers, estimators, and field teams to ensure seamless integration of design and installation.
  • Mentor junior engineers, fostering professional growth and industry best practices.
Qualifications
  • A bachelor's degree in mechanical Engineering, Business, or a related field is preferred; advanced leadership training or industry certifications are a plus.
  • 5+ years of experience in mechanical design for commercial HVAC systems.
  • Advanced proficiency in Revit, AutoCAD, Navisworks, and Bluebeam for mechanical system modeling and documentation.
  • Strong understanding of California building codes, ASHRAE standards, and Title 24 compliance.
  • In-depth knowledge of Los Angeles HVAC regulations and construction standards.
  • Local and stable work history with a proven track record in commercial mechanical design.
